common model with which all vendors can work. A CIM-enabled storage management environment will deliver significant benefits to customers, including the ability to:

1.Overcome the Challenges Created by De-coupling Storage Resources from Specific Server(s) in a SAN

Neither a single vendor solution nor individual point solutions can meet customers’

long-term comprehensive storage management and interoperability requirements. Customers need assurance that products deployed today can be expanded and enhanced to meet emerging interoperability requirements by adherence to open industry standards, such as CIM.

2.View and Operate Networked Storage as a Holistic Resource

CIM provides a common, normalized, yet extensible view of these resources, their

relationships, and the operations that can be performed against them.

By spanning the management of all components in the storage stack, from the application to the physical storage medium, CIM allows a management application to be as focused or all-encompassing as it needs to be, all within a single standard.

3.Avoid Being "Locked" into a Proprietary Management Environment

Storage management vendors supporting heterogeneous, interoperable environments

must differentiate their value based on products, services, and solutions, and not because their customers are locked into distinct management frameworks incompatible with other SAN elements. Customers who choose new and innovative companies that can create competitive or complementary functionality (built on existing management infrastructure and components based on the CIM standard) realize investment protection, greater choice, purchasing leverage, and additional options.
